Asynchronously writes an ArrayBuffer to a file.

Example

var FileSystem = require("FuseJS/FileSystem");

var data = new ArrayBuffer(4);
var view = new Int32Array(data);
view[0] = 0x1337;

FileSystem.writeBufferToFile(FileSystem.dataDirectory + "/" + "myfile.txt", data)
    .then(function() {
        console.log("Successful write");
    }, function(error) {
        console.log(error);
    });

Location

Namespace
Fuse.FileSystem
Package
Fuse.FileSystem 2.7.0

Returns

Promise

A Promise of nothing.